/*
* (C) 2003 Linux Networx, SuSE Linux AG
* 2006.1 yhlu add dest apicid for IRQ0
*/
#include <console/console.h>
#include <device/device.h>
#include <device/pci.h>
#include <device/pci_ids.h>
#include <device/pci_ops.h>
#include <pc80/mc146818rtc.h>
#include <pc80/isa-dma.h>
#include <cpu/x86/lapic.h>
#include <arch/ioapic.h>
#include <stdlib.h>
#include "amd8111.h"
#define NMI_OFF 0
static void enable_hpet(struct device *dev)
{
unsigned long hpet_address;
pci_write_config32(dev,0xa0, 0xfed00001);
hpet_address = pci_read_config32(dev,0xa0)& 0xfffffffe;
printk(BIOS_DEBUG, "enabling HPET @0x%lx\n", hpet_address);
}
static void lpc_init(struct device *dev)
{
uint8_t byte;
int nmi_option;
/* IO APIC initialization */
byte = pci_read_config8(dev, 0x4B);
byte |= 1;
pci_write_config8(dev, 0x4B, byte);
/* Don't rename IO APIC */
setup_ioapic(IO_APIC_ADDR, 0);
/* posted memory write enable */
byte = pci_read_config8(dev, 0x46);
pci_write_config8(dev, 0x46, byte | (1<<0));
/* Enable 5Mib Rom window */
byte = pci_read_config8(dev, 0x43);
byte |= 0xc0;
pci_write_config8(dev, 0x43, byte);
/* Enable Port 92 fast reset */
byte = pci_read_config8(dev, 0x41);
byte |= (1 << 5);
pci_write_config8(dev, 0x41, byte);
/* Enable Error reporting */
/* Set up sync flood detected */
byte = pci_read_config8(dev, 0x47);
byte |= (1 << 1);
pci_write_config8(dev, 0x47, byte);
/* Set up NMI on errors */
byte = pci_read_config8(dev, 0x40);
byte |= (1 << 1); /* clear PW2LPC error */
byte |= (1 << 6); /* clear LPCERR */
pci_write_config8(dev, 0x40, byte);
nmi_option = NMI_OFF;
get_option(&nmi_option, "nmi");
if (nmi_option) {
byte |= (1 << 7); /* set NMI */
pci_write_config8(dev, 0x40, byte);
}
/* Initialize the real time clock */
rtc_init(0);
/* Initialize isa dma */
isa_dma_init();
/* Initialize the High Precision Event Timers */
enable_hpet(dev);
}
static void amd8111_lpc_read_resources(device_t dev)
{
struct resource *res;
/* Get the normal PCI resources of this device. */
pci_dev_read_resources(dev);
/* Add an extra subtractive resource for both memory and I/O. */
res = new_resource(dev, IOINDEX_SUBTRACTIVE(0, 0));
res->base = 0;
res->size = 0x1000;
res->flags = IORESOURCE_IO | IORESOURCE_SUBTRACTIVE |
IORESOURCE_ASSIGNED | IORESOURCE_FIXED;
res = new_resource(dev, IOINDEX_SUBTRACTIVE(1, 0));
res->base = 0xff800000;
res->size = 0x00800000; /* 8 MB for flash */
res->flags = IORESOURCE_MEM | IORESOURCE_SUBTRACTIVE |
IORESOURCE_ASSIGNED | IORESOURCE_FIXED;
res = new_resource(dev, 3); /* IOAPIC */
res->base = IO_APIC_ADDR;
res->size = 0x00001000;
res->flags = IORESOURCE_MEM | IORESOURCE_ASSIGNED | IORESOURCE_FIXED;
}
static void lpci_set_subsystem(device_t dev, unsigned vendor, unsigned device)
{
pci_write_config32(dev, 0x70,
((device & 0xffff) << 16) | (vendor & 0xffff));
}
static struct pci_operations lops_pci = {
.set_subsystem = lpci_set_subsystem,
};
static struct device_operations lpc_ops = {
.read_resources = amd8111_lpc_read_resources,
.set_resources = pci_dev_set_resources,
.enable_resources = pci_dev_enable_resources,
.init = lpc_init,
.scan_bus = scan_static_bus,
.enable = amd8111_enable,
.ops_pci = &lops_pci,
};
static const struct pci_driver lpc_driver __pci_driver = {
.ops = &lpc_ops,
.vendor = PCI_VENDOR_ID_AMD,
.device = PCI_DEVICE_ID_AMD_8111_ISA,
};
